What is Anastrozole?
Anastrozole is an aromatase inhibitor commonly used in the treatment of breast cancer. It works by preventing the conversion of androgens into estrogens, which can be beneficial for bodybuilders seeking to manage estrogen levels during cycles of anabolic steroids.

Potential Side Effects
While anastrozole can be effective in managing estrogen levels, it is not without potential side effects. Users may experience:
- Joint pain
- Hot flashes
- Fatigue
- Bone density loss with prolonged use
Therefore, it is vital to use this medication cautiously and under the guidance of a healthcare professional, particularly for those using it in a non-medical context like bodybuilding.
